Elements to Consider When Choosing a Custom Front Door

Picking the ideal custom front door includes a number of crucial considerations. Here are some critical aspects to keep in mind:

1. Material Options

Custom doors are available in a range of products, each with distinct residential or commercial properties. The most typical products consist of:

  • Wood: Offers a classic look with natural appeal however may require more maintenance.
  • Fiberglass: Resists warping and is energy efficient, typically simulating the look of wood.
  • Steel: Provides robust security and toughness, though it might not have the same visual appeal as wood or fiberglass.
  • Aluminum: Lightweight and resistant to corrosion, suitable for modern homes.

2. Design Style

The style of your front door should complement your home's architectural style. Choices include:

  • Traditional: Classic panel designs often found in colonial or Victorian homes.
  • Modern: Sleek lines, minimalist styles, and glass accents.
  • Artisan: Characterized by rich wood surfaces and complex information.
  • Rustic: Features natural products and textures, suitable for nation or farmhouse designs.

The Installation Process

The procedure of setting up a custom front door typically includes the following steps:

  1. Measurement: The installer takes precise measurements of the existing door frame.
  2. Product Selection: Homeowners choose the door material, style, and security functions.
  3. Production: The door is handcrafted according to the selected requirements.
  4. Preparation: Existing door hardware is gotten rid of, and the frame is prepared.
  5. Installation: The new door is awaited the frame, and changes are made for alignment.
  6. Completing Touches: Trim, weather condition removing, and locks are installed, and the door is sealed for energy efficiency.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: How long does it take to install a custom front door?

A1: The common installation process can take anywhere from a few hours to a complete day, depending upon the complexity of the installation and any extra modifications.

Q2: Can a custom front door improve my home's worth?

A2: Yes, a custom front door can improve the curb appeal of your home, potentially increasing its market price.

Q3: What is the average cost of a custom front door?

A3: Costs can range widely, usually from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 5,000 or more, depending on products and labor.
